Title: Program Manager - Marketing Events I
Contract Duration: 4 months (2026-06-15 to 2026-10-30)
Location: Hybrid at San Francisco, CA 94105 (3 days/week in-office)
Pay rate: $55-$58/hr on W2
Location & Flexibility: Ability to work from the San Francisco office 3 days per week, with flexibility for event-day schedules.
 
Description:
We are hiring for an execution-focused Events Lead, Recruiting Programs to deliver of a high-volume, high-touch event portfolio spanning both recruiting events and intern program experiences. Your main responsibility is to manage day-to-day event logistics while documenting standard operating procedures (SOPs) needed to scale. This role is based in San Francisco and requires a 3 day/week in-office presence to handle on-site logistics and administrative tasks.
 
Core Responsibilities
  • Operational Support & Logistics: Partner with the Global Strategic Event Manager to execute a high volume of logistics-heavy events, taking ownership of the day-to-day moving parts, planning timelines, and execution.
  • Build Scale & SOPs: Turn fast-moving event workflows into documented, repeatable standard operating procedures (SOPs) and playbooks to ensure our event program can scale efficiently across the region.
  • Event Tech & Admin: Manage event platforms (building registration pages, troubleshooting, and tracking attendee lists).
  • Vendor Management & Tracking: Serve as point of contact for external partners (venues, caterers, AV production). Coordinate deliverables, review proposals, and ensure flawless on-site execution.
  • Budgeting & Post-Event Analytics: Maintain meticulous budget trackers to ensure financial reconciliation. Lead post-event evaluations, compile attendee feedback metrics, and deliver data-driven recommendations for future event optimization.
 
Requested Experience
  • Professional Experience: 3–5 years of hands-on event coordination, operations, or project management experience handling high-volume, logistics-heavy portfolios.
  • Target Audience Familiarity: Prior experience supporting recruiting events, university recruiting, or early-career/intern programs is highly preferred.
  • Process & Systems Organization: A proven track record of organizing complex workflows into documented standard operating procedures (SOPs), checklists, or repeatable playbooks.
  • Event Technology: Strong familiarity with event management software; Splash or Cvent experience is highly preferred.
  • Project Management Skills: Exceptional attention to detail, timeline management, and strong administrative skills.
  • On-Site Execution: Experience coordinating third-party vendors and production crews on-site during live events.
  • Communication: Highly communicative and proactive.
  • Must have skills: Event Planning, Vendor Management, Timeline Management, Documentation
  • Teachable skills: Event Technology
